WebSSH is an awesome SSH, SFTP, TELNET and Port Forwarding client ٩(^‿^)۶
Wherever you are it will be useful to you everywhere, all the time!
◖ SSH Functionalities ◗
๏ Authentication using : password, challenge (two factor authentication), RSA / DSA / ED25519 / PuTTY Private Key, Port Knocking
๏ Port Forwarding (Local)
๏ Launch a command at connection startup
๏ Emulation : XTERM-COLOR256 / XTERM / VT100
๏ Profil management : themes, background / foreground colors, font size, backspace sequence
๏ Keyboard : Virtual or Bluetooth
๏ Special keys Esc, Tab, Ctrl, /, :, -, !, |, $, *
◖ SFTP Functionalities ◗
๏ Create / Rename / Delete files and directories
๏ Edit text files
๏ Upload files from your device to your server
๏ Download files from your server to your device
◖ TELNET Functionalities ◗
๏ Ability to launch a connection without authentication or using keyboard-interactive authentication
◖ Sysadmin Tools ◗
๏ Addresses
๏ Ping
๏ Whois
๏ Traceroute
๏ DNS Lookup
◖ mashREPL ◗
๏ Use a local terminal without any Internet connection!
๏ Run commands such as : awk, bc, cat, cd, cp, curl, date, dig, du, echo, env, find, grep, head, help, host, ifconfig, ls, mkdir, mv, nslookup, open, openurl, ping, printenv, pwd, rm, sed, setenv, sort, stat, tail, tar, touch, uname, unsetenv, uptime, wc, whoami, whois
◖ Access Protection ◗
๏ Touch ID / Face ID
๏ Password
◖ Supported protocols ◗
๏ SSH
๏ SFTP
๏ TELNET
◖ Supported channel types ◗
๏ Session Shell
๏ Session SFTP
๏ Local Port Forward

servicefeature_requestsdesignperformance_and_bugsThis app makes it really easy to make ssh connections on iOS. It does have a few shortcomings though. The SFTP implementation doesn’t support folders, so if you want to upload or download a whole directory, you have to zip it first. It also has a weird separation between SSH and SFTP. If you want to connect to the same machine using both, you have to add it twice. It also treats the keyboard weirdly. You can tap the screen to “put away” your keyboard, which disables input from the hardware keyboard. Useful for on-screen keyboard users, I guess, but annoying for the rest of us. When setting up a new connection the little menu for the text field constantly disappears before you can tap it, so you have to use cmd-v if you’re pasting a password or something.
